Description

This 2 bedroom detached bungalow is situated in the Watcombe Park area of Torquay with easy access to all local amenities including shops, Watcombe Primary School with on-site Nursery, golf course, model village, walking distance to Brunel Woods, with its glorious walks, Watcombe and Maidencombe beaches, whilst Torquay town centre is a short distance away with its further range of amenities to include shops, pubs, restaurants, beaches, Princess Theatre, Torre Abbey Historic house and gardens, bus routes, Torbay Hospital plus easy access to Torquay and Torre train stations.

The internal accommodation comprises entrance porch leading to entrance hallway, lounge and sun lounge, kitchen/dining room with built-in appliances, 2 double bedrooms, shower room and drop down stairs leading to a loft room/office.

Other benefits include gas central heating supplied by a newly fitted Worcester boiler which is also hydrogen compatible, water heater, uPVC double glazing, garage with electric roller door, workshop/laundry room ideal for those raising a family, a summerhouse, ample off road parking and gardens.
